Output 8d708a865e42fdb9b7c7c5cde388ffb6a8d9a5bc259460d8102ea2a09e407e98:52

value
1084881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ebe51f7622830b4ef1bd251187ca873c820eabdb OP_EQUAL
address
3PCKCMwTTQdcqTvYWdr5RB4ZEt6rt8QjbC
transaction
8d708a865e42fdb9b7c7c5cde388ffb6a8d9a5bc259460d8102ea2a09e407e98
confirmations
216220
spent
true